Mark chromeos_tbmc as wake capable and report wake events. This helps to
abort suspend on seeing a tablet mode switch event when kernel is
suspending. This also helps identifying if chromeos_tbmc is the wake
source.

Clang warns:
drivers/platform/chrome/chromeos_tbmc.c:102:14: warning: duplicate
'const' declaration specifier [-Wduplicate-decl-specifier]
static const SIMPLE_DEV_PM_OPS(chromeos_tbmc_pm_ops, NULL,
^
./include/linux/pm.h:365:56: note: expanded from macro
'SIMPLE_DEV_PM_OPS'
^
1 warning generated.
SIMPLE_DEV_PM_OPS is already declared as const, this one is unnecessary
so remove it.

Add a kernel driver for GOOG0006, an ACPI driver reporting an event when
the tablet switch status changes.
On an ACPI based convertible chromebook check evtest display tablet mode
switch changes:
Available devices:
..
/dev/input/event3: Tablet Mode Switch
..
Testing ... (interrupt to exit)
Event: time 1484879712.604360, type 5 (EV_SW), code 1 (SW_TABLET_MODE),
value 1
Event: time 1484879712.604360, -------------- SYN_REPORT ------------
Event: time 1484879715.132228, type 5 (EV_SW), code 1 (SW_TABLET_MODE),
value 0
Event: time 1484879715.132228, -------------- SYN_REPORT ------------
...
Check state is updated at resume time when different from suspend time.
